Term:desensitization of G protein-coupled receptor signaling pathway
go back to main search page
Accession:GO:0002029 term browser browse the term
Definition:The process that stops, prevents, or reduces the frequency, rate or extent of G protein-coupled receptor signaling pathway after prolonged stimulation with an agonist of the pathway.
Synonyms:exact_synonym: desensitisation of G-protein coupled receptor protein signalling pathway;   desensitization of G-protein coupled receptor protein signaling pathway
